Folk tradition - the source of the oldest Polish musical idioms - was passed from generation to generation in the process of oral tradition.  Music has always been an indispensable form of entertainment at peasant festivities, gatherings in marketplaces or village inns and wedding feasts at royal courts.  On these occasions folk and court traditions interwove.  However, since the 16th century the distance between folk music and art music became more evident.   As we know from historical sources it was about that time that the Polish style in music emerged.  It can be best seen in so called Polish dances - choreae  polonicae, which gained enormous popularity in 17th century Europe.
The 16th and especially the 17th lute and organ tabulatures include a lot of such dances both in two beat and three beat time as a combination of two metrically contrasting parts.  Our intention was to present the mergence of folk archtypes with artistic creations in the course of history.  Although our music comes from authentic sources, we do not intend to just reconstruct performance tradition of the past, but also taking into account expectations of today's listener we try to find new and attractive ways of presenting the world of forgotten music.  The whole image of our group results not only from our repertoire and its special interpretation but also from the use of archaic instruments.
Unique copies of Polish historical instruments which have vanished - the suka from Bilgoraj, the fiddle from Plock, as well as a typical rural hollow violin and a hollow bass.  Apart from string instruments we also play other instruments deeply rooted in folk music: the dulcimer, the pipes, the bagpipe and the drums.
